Current Context: The Telangana government and Godrej Capital signed an MoU on April 9, 2025, in Hyderabad with the primary aim of enhancing credit access for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s).
Telangana & Godrej Capital Signed MoU to Enhance Credit Access for MSMEs
  • This partnership focuses on providing digital-first lending solutions tailored to underserved and first-time borrowers.
Key highlights:
  • Emphasis on financial inclusion for women entrepreneurs through Godrej Capital's Aarohi initiative.
  • Support aligns with Telangana's MSME Policy 2024, aiming to foster inclusive growth and innovation.
  • Boosts entrepreneurship while creating a stronger ecosystem for economic growth in the MSME sector.
